when a tool outputs an unsorted bam file, the indexing fails (quietly)
and its metadata variable "bam_index" points to an inexistent file. This
causes a nasty bug when trying to import the dataset into a data library
and actually makes the library unusable unless you delete the broken
entry from the - in my case Postgresql - database by hand. Are you
working on it?
